How Kerala Lottery Prizes Are Tiered

Every Kerala State Lottery scheme, including Sthree Sakthi, distributes prizes across a set of tiers rather than a single jackpot. At the top is the first prize, the largest single award. Below it sit the second and third prizes, then a series of lower tiers that award smaller fixed amounts to many more winning numbers. This tiered design means a single draw produces a large number of winners at the lower levels, not just one. Lower Tiers and How They Add Up

Beneath the top three prizes, Sthree Sakthi awards several lower tiers, often labelled from the fourth prize downward. These lower tiers pay smaller fixed amounts but cover far more winning numbers, which is why many ticket holders win something at these levels even when the top prizes go elsewhere. The structure is designed so that the prize pool is spread across a wide base of smaller wins in addition to the few large ones at the top.

The Consolation Prize Explained

Kerala schemes include a consolation prize, and Sthree Sakthi is no exception. A consolation prize is awarded to tickets that carry the same number as the first-prize ticket but belong to a different series. In practice, if the first-prize number matches your ticket number but not your series, you may still qualify for the consolation amount. It is a fixed figure set alongside the other tiers and confirmed in the official result sheet.

How the Prize Pool Is Distributed

A helpful way to picture the structure is as a pool shared unevenly across many winners. Within the official Kerala State Lotteries system, a portion of ticket revenue funds the prize pool, and that pool is divided into tiers rather than paid out as a single jackpot. The first prize takes the largest single share, the second and third prizes take smaller shares, and the many lower tiers together account for a broad spread of modest wins. This is deliberate: it means a draw rewards a large number of ticket holders at the lower levels while still offering one headline figure at the top. Because the department periodically revises how the pool is set, the official source remains the only place to confirm current figures.

Understanding Odds Across the Tiers

The tiered design also shapes your realistic chances. Matching the full first-prize number is a long-odds outcome, which is why the first prize is large. The lower tiers, which often match only the last few digits of a drawn number, are far more likely to produce a small win, though each pays a modest fixed amount. Understanding this balance keeps expectations honest: buying more tickets does not change the fundamental odds of any single ticket, and no pattern or system can improve them, because each draw is independent. Treat the ticket price as the cost of taking part, not as a stake you expect to grow.

Confirming Prices and Avoiding Fake Claims

Always confirm the current ticket price and prize amounts at the point of purchase through official channels, since both can be revised. Be wary of any seller quoting an unusual price or any message claiming you have won and then requesting a fee. Advance-fee lottery scams work exactly this way, promising a large prize and asking for a small payment or your bank details first; genuine Kerala prizes never require that.
